What we do for blinds after water exposure in Fairfield Heights
Fairfield Heights properties often sit close to busy streets and older drainage layouts, so sudden roof leaks, overflow from gardens, or burst supply lines can affect window coverings sooner than people notice.
Blinds trap moisture in the slats, folds, and cords. Even after the visible water is gone, residue can dry unevenly and create a persistent damp odour that draws dust and makes rooms feel less fresh.
Our process starts with identifying the blind material and the source of contamination. Then we clean with methods suited to the blind, focusing on removing both visible soil and the residue that causes ongoing smells.
If nearby water damage is still active, we coordinate with the broader drying and sanitation priorities first so your blinds do not re-soak or continue to carry moisture.

Why cleaning blinds promptly matters in Fairfield Heights
- Early action reduces the chance of damp residue drying into slats and fabric edges.
- Clean blinds help prevent dust from sticking more quickly in high-humidity conditions.
- Odour can travel through airflow from vents and doors, so untreated blinds may keep a room smelling stale.
- If water exposure was significant, cleaning after the main moisture source is controlled gives better results.
- For apartments and townhouses, quicker turnaround helps avoid longer disruption to living spaces.
- In garages and storage-adjacent rooms, blinds near the back of the house can be exposed to humidity spikes and odours.
